    Bread Conversation Questions with Answers

    Beginner-Level Bread Question

    1. What is your favorite type of bread?
      • My favorite type of bread is sourdough because of its tangy flavor and chewy texture.
    2. Do you prefer white bread or whole grain bread?
      • I prefer whole grain bread because it is healthier and has more fiber.
    3. Have you ever tried making bread at home?
      • Yes, I’ve tried making bread at home, and it was a fun experience!
    4. What is a common type of bread in your country?
      • A common type of bread in my country is baguette, which is often served with meals.
    5. Do you enjoy eating bread with butter?
      • Yes, I love eating bread with butter, especially when the bread is warm.
    6. Have you ever tasted bread from another country?
      • Yes, I’ve tasted naan from India, and it was delicious with curry.
    7. What do you usually eat with bread?
      • I usually eat bread with cheese or jam for breakfast.
    8. Do you prefer soft bread or crusty bread?
      • I prefer soft bread because it’s easier to chew and enjoy.
    9. What is your favorite sandwich made with bread?
      • My favorite sandwich is a classic grilled cheese sandwich.
    10. How often do you eat bread?
      • I eat bread almost every day, often as part of my meals.

    Intermediate-Level Bread Question

    11. How do you think bread is important in your culture?

    – Bread is important in my culture as it is often part of family gatherings and celebrations.

    12. What bread-related traditions do you have in your family?

    – In my family, we have a tradition of baking bread together during holidays.

    13. Do you enjoy trying different types of bread from around the world?

    – Yes, I enjoy trying different types of bread as each one has a unique taste and history.

    14. How does bread play a role in your daily meals?

    – Bread is a staple in my meals; I often use it for sandwiches or as a side with soups.

    15. What is your opinion on artisanal bread?

    – I think artisanal bread is fantastic because of the craftsmanship and quality ingredients used.

    16. Have you ever participated in a bread-making workshop?

    – Yes, I participated in a workshop once, and it was a great learning experience.

    17. What do you think about gluten-free bread options?

    – I think gluten-free bread options are great for those with dietary restrictions.

    18. Can you name a bread that is typically served at celebrations?

    – A bread that is typically served at celebrations is challah, especially during Jewish holidays.

    19. How do you feel about bread as a comfort food?

    – I feel that bread is a wonderful comfort food; it reminds me of home and warmth.

    20. What is a popular bread dish in your country?

    – A popular bread dish in my country is bruschetta, often topped with tomatoes and basil.

    21. How do you think bread has evolved over the years?

    – I think bread has evolved with more varieties and adaptations for health trends and diets.

    22. What is your favorite way to eat leftover bread?

    – My favorite way to eat leftover bread is to make croutons or bread pudding.

    23. How do you think bread can bring people together?

    – Bread can bring people together by sharing meals, traditions, and recipes, fostering connections.

    24. What is a unique bread you have encountered in your travels?

    – I encountered a type of bread called focaccia in Italy; it was flavorful and herb-infused.

    25. How do you feel about bread served with soups?

    – I love bread served with soups; it adds a nice texture and complements the flavors.

    26. What are some common ingredients used in bread-making?

    – Common ingredients in bread-making include flour, water, yeast, and salt.

    27. What is a traditional bread from your region?

    – A traditional bread from my region is rye bread, often enjoyed with various toppings.

    28. How has your taste in bread changed over time?

    – My taste in bread has changed as I’ve become more open to trying different types and flavors.

    29. Do you think bread can be a healthy part of a diet?

    – Yes, I believe bread can be healthy, especially whole grain varieties that provide nutrients.

    30. What role does bread play in your family gatherings?

    – Bread plays a central role in family gatherings, often as part of the meal and shared among everyone.

    Advanced-Level Bread Question

    31. How do you view the relationship between bread and cultural identity?

    – I view bread as a vital part of cultural identity, reflecting traditions, history, and community values.

    32. In what ways do you think bread can symbolize hospitality?

    – Bread symbolizes hospitality as it is often offered to guests as a sign of welcome and sharing.

    33. How do you think social media has influenced bread consumption trends?

    – Social media has influenced trends by showcasing various bread recipes and encouraging home baking.

    34. What are the implications of the gluten-free movement on traditional bread-making?

    – The gluten-free movement has led to the innovation of alternative flours and bread-making techniques.

    35. How does bread feature in religious or spiritual practices in your culture?

    – Bread features in religious practices like communion or festivals, symbolizing sustenance and community.

    36. What are your thoughts on the sustainability of bread production?

    – I believe sustainability in bread production is crucial, focusing on local ingredients and eco-friendly practices.

    37. How do you think bread can be a metaphor for life’s challenges?

    – Bread can be a metaphor for life’s challenges as it requires patience and care to rise and develop fully.

    38. In what ways do you think bread-making can be an art form?

    – Bread-making can be an art form through the creativity of flavors, shapes, and presentation.

    39. How does the globalization of food affect local bread traditions?

    – Globalization can dilute local bread traditions but also fosters exchange and innovation in recipes.

    40. How do you see the future of bread evolving in the context of health and wellness?

    – I see the future of bread evolving with a focus on nutritional content and innovative ingredients catering to health trends.

    41. What role does bread play in the economy of your country?

    – Bread plays a significant role in the economy through local bakeries, agriculture, and food industries.
